Value of CT fluoroscopy for lumbar facet blocks.

Sherif Meleka1, Ajanta Patra, Evan Minkoff, Kieran Murphy.   

Abstract

We compared the diagnostic accuracy of lumbar facet blocks guided by either conventional fluoroscopy or CT fluoroscopy (CTF). Seventy-one blocks were performed with conventional fluoroscopy, and 58 were performed using CTF. Pain scores were measured before and after the procedure. The CTF group had a greater percentage decrease in pain (79.5% +/- 31.1%) than did the conventional fluoroscopy group (55.5% +/- 38.0%; P < .0005). We conclude lumbar facet blocks by using CTF guidance results in greater diagnostic accuracy than do conventional fluoroscopy.
